Q: Why did you choose to come to Wyoming?

A: I chose Wyoming for many reasons. The facilities were some of the best in the country and the coaching staff showed unbelievable support/love. They really expressed that they care about their recruits and they really believe in me and my abilities as a football player. I also believe in the program coach Bohl & I love the job coach Bohl has done and will continue to do with this team

Q: What position will you play at UW?

A: I talked to Coach (Jay) Sawvel about playing DB (Nickel and Safety) that’s what I’m being recruited for. But I’m an athlete on the recruiting board so I expect to see some time on special teams maybe as a returner

Q: What are you looking forward to most about playing in Laramie?

A: I’m looking forward to getting on campus and meeting new people and getting a feel for the town and living a new lifestyle outside of the big city in Chicago

Q: This is obviously a weird year, did you have a chance to even visit Laramie with no official visits this fall?

A: I unfortunately have not been able to visit Wyoming

Q: What do you want Wyoming fans to know about you?

A: I want the Wyoming fans to know that I’m a hard-working competitor from Chicago and I’m excited to be apart of the Wyoming football team and the love that they show is unmatched. They can expect big plays/things from me for the next 4-5 years
